Detroit airports

Detroit Metropolitan Wayne County Airport (DTW) is the main airport serving Detroit.

Airport information

Detroit Metropolitan Wayne County Airport (DTW)

Detroit Metropolitan Wayne County Airport (DTW) is located in Romulus, Michigan, and serves as a major hub for Delta Air Lines. It offers flights from ATL to Detroit and other destinations. You can find cheap flights from Atlanta to Detroit and other amazing deals on eDreams.

Airport facilities:

  • ATMs
  • Wi-Fi
  • Bottle filling stations
  • Kids play areas
  • Family restrooms
  • Nursing rooms
  • Prayer rooms
  • Pet relief areas

Getting to the city center from Detroit Metropolitan Wayne County Airport (DTW):

  • Public transportation: The Detroit Air Xpress (DAX) bus service connects the airport to downtown Detroit. The Suburban Mobility Authority for Regional Transportation (SMART) bus system also serves the airport, with routes to various destinations in the metro area.
  • Taxi: Taxis are readily available outside the terminals.
  • Car: Detroit Metropolitan Wayne County Airport (DTW) is easily accessible by car via Interstate 94.

What to do and see in Detroit

Detroit, also known as the Motor City, is a fascinating destination with a rich history and vibrant culture. If you're flying in from Atlanta, make sure to book your Atlanta to Detroit flights in advance, especially if you're looking for cheap flights from Atlanta to Detroit. Once you've secured your ATL to Detroit flights, start planning your itinerary with these must-do activities:

  • Explore the Detroit Institute of Arts: Immerse yourself in art from around the world at this renowned museum, home to masterpieces from various periods and movements.
  • Discover Automotive History at the Henry Ford Museum: Journey through American innovation at this expansive museum, featuring iconic automobiles, historical artifacts, and interactive exhibits.
  • Stroll Along the Detroit Riverwalk: Enjoy scenic views of the Detroit River and the city skyline as you wander along this revitalized waterfront promenade.
